Bhallukota - Kurupam, Parvathipuram Manyam

Bhallukota is a village situated in the Kurupam mandal of Parvathipuram Manyam district, Andhra Pradesh. It is located approximately 6 km from Kurupam and around 123 km from Vizianagaram. Gotivada serves as the Gram Panchayat for Bhallukota village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Bhallukota is 582004. The village covers a total geographical area of 145 hectares and falls under the 535524 pincode. Parvathipuram is the nearest town, located about 37 km away.

Bhallukota village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Bhallukota

As per Census 2011, Bhallukota village has a total population of 145 people, consisting of 69 males and 76 females. The village has 44 households and a sex ratio of 1,101 females per 1,000 males. There are 11 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 83 literate and 62 illiterate residents. Additionally, 142 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Bhallukota

Public transport facilities are available within 2-5 km of the Bhallukota. The nearest railway station is Gumada, while the nearest airport is Jeypore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 85.7 km.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Parvathipuram to Bhallukota is about 37 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Vizianagaram to Bhallukota is about 123 km, with the usual travel time around ~3.5 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
